Discover more about Brooklyn Children's Museum

The Brooklyn Children's Museum stands as a beacon of creativity and education for young minds and their families. Nestled in the heart of Crown Heights, this innovative space is the first children's museum in the United States, offering a plethora of exhibits that engage children in a hands-on learning experience. With a focus on culture, science, and art, the museum allows children to explore various interactive displays, from a vibrant art studio to an immersive science lab, each designed to stimulate curiosity and foster a love for learning. One of the standout features of the museum is its commitment to cultural diversity. Exhibits often highlight the rich history and traditions of Brooklyn's communities, making it a fantastic educational resource for both locals and tourists. Children can delve into the world of different cultures through storytelling, crafts, and interactive experiences that bring global traditions to life. The museum also places a strong emphasis on environmental education, encouraging young visitors to learn about sustainability through engaging activities and exhibits.
